HC Deb 06 December 1944 vol 406 c555W
Mr. J. Dugdale

asked the Secretary of State for the Colonies if, in order to make it more representative, any plans are on foot for the revision of the Legislative Council of Nigeria.

Mr. Sorensen

asked the Secretary of State for the Colonies, in view of the prospective new Gold Coast constitution with an unofficial majority on its Legislative Council, whether it is also proposed to reconstitute the Nigerian Legislative Council with a view to securing wider representation of Nigerian inhabitants.

Colonel Stanley

I am not at present in a position to make a statement with regard to constitutional development in Nigeria.
